Understanding Entropy and Thermodynamic Processes by randhirrayjsr17 is a document available to read on EtoBox.

The document discusses the concepts of reversible and irreversible processes, highlighting that spontaneous changes in a system are irreversible and lead to an increase in entropy. It introduces entropy as a measure of irreversibility and explains its relationship with heat flow and temperature. Additionally, it covers free energy, specifically Gibbs and Helmholtz free energy, as tools for determining thermodynamic equilibrium and the conditions under which reactions occur.
